Oral Medications

  • Anticholinergics and beta blockers can help with hyperhidrosis.
  • Anticholinergics decrease sweat all over the body.
  • Anticholinergics are good for people with secondary hyperhidrosis or those who sweat a lot in the face
  • Anticholinergics side effects include dry mouth, constipation, urinary retention, heart palpitations, and blurred vision.
  • Beta blockers block the physical response to anxiety.
  • Beta blockers are not recommended for long-term use.
  • Beta blockers can cause tiredness, dizziness, and depression.

Laser Treatment

  • This treatment destroys underarm sweat glands with heat.
  • This treatment isn’t offered by many doctors.
  • This treatment is expensive, usually around $3,000 per treatment.
  • Laster treatment side effects include temporary swelling, numbness, and bruising.

Endoscopic Thoracic Surgery (ETS)

  • This is performed under general anesthesia.
  • The nerves that carry messages to the sweat glands are cut.
  • This procedure helps with hyperhidrosis in the face, hands, and armpits.
  • It is expensive and can cost anywhere from $5,000 to $10,000.
  • Side effects can include scarring, loss of sensation in the armpits, compensatory sweating, infection, and arrhythmia.
  • This surgery is irreversible.
